NCM523 (LiNiCoMnO₂, Ni:Co:Mn = 5:2:3) Cathode Powder for High-Power Li-ion Batteries – 200 g

https://www.s4r.fr/web/image/product.template/30/image_1920?unique=ce393d6
This NCM523 (LiNiCoMnO₂) cathode powder is designed for high-power lithium-ion battery applications.

With a balanced Ni:Co:Mn ratio of 5:2:3, it offers a good compromise between capacity, power capability, and cycling stability.

The powder features controlled particle size distribution, low impurity levels, and stable electrochemical performance, making it suitable for laboratory-scale cathode fabrication and electrochemical evaluation.

Specification
Material Identification Chemical Formula LiNiCoMnO₂ (NCM523)
Element Ratio Ni:Co:Mn = 5:2:3
Appearance Dark brown powder, air-stable
Particle Size Distribution D10 ≤ 5.0 µm
D50 10.0 – 14.0 µm
D90 ≥ 25.0 µm
Chemical Composition Ni + Co + Mn ≥ 58 %
Lithium (Li) 7.00 – 8.00 %
Impurities Iron (Fe) ≤ 0.01 %
Sodium (Na) ≤ 0.03 %
Copper (Cu) ≤ 0.005 %
Moisture & pH Residual Moisture (H₂O) ≤ 0.1 %
pH Value ≤ 11.5
Physical Properties Specific Surface Area 0.20 – 0.40 m²/g
Electrochemical Performance Specific Capacity (1st cycle) 153 – 158 mAh/g
Coulombic Efficiency (1st cycle) ≥ 85 %
Test Conditions Electrochemical Test 0.2 C, 4.2–2.7 V vs Li/Li⁺ (Half-cell)
